The scope of our project is to notify the owner of the premises, the fire department and authority immediately after the detecting any fire and gas leakage by sensor. The notification is sent through Short Message Services (SMS). The issue we are trying to solve here is associated with the emergencies which can occur in any industry or large factories in this case fire. This can also help us to reduce the response time taken by the first responders. As soon as the sensors detect fire or smoke buzzer will go off and SMS will be sent to all the authorities. The path to the development of the automation system at home and in industry is almost the same these days. This paper will help us to understand the measures which we can take to create a fail safe system for fire or gas detection in large areas at low cost. Everyone wants to be safe as much as possible. The easy connection simple to understand will help every user to use the wireless system for security using the sensors-Gas, smoke, and temperature detector at industries.
